Molecular Identity Full Name Body Protection Compound 157 Structure Pentadecapeptide (15 amino acids) Sequence Gly-Glu-Pro-Pro-Pro-Gly-Lys-Pro-Ala-Asp-Asp-Ala-Gly-Leu-Val Molecular Weight ~1419 g/mol Origin Synthetic fragment derived from human gastric juice protein Mechanism of Action Published research identifies several pathways through which BPC-157 may affect tissue: Angiogenesis promotion: Studies show BPC-157 promotes blood vessel formation in animal models (Seiwerth et al., 2018) Nitric oxide system modulation: Interactions with NO pathways have been documented Growth factor activity: Research indicates effects on VEGF and EGF pathways FAK-paxillin pathway: Cell migration studies show activation of focal adhesion kinase Published Research Study Focus Model Publication Seiwerth et al
